Measurement, Evaluation, & Learning Program

In 2022, Women Moving Millions launched a Measurement, Evaluation, and Learning program to develop clear, evidence-based insights into how WMM drives transformative, gender-equitable change, and how our members are shifting norms, practices, and outcomes in philanthropy.

Through the program, we aim to better understand our impact on our membership community and the gender lens philanthropy our members practice, and how our contribution is strengthening the funding ecosystem of the gender equality movement. By building a body of knowledge, insights, and best practices, we seek to improve our core community building work and further our mission to catalyze greater resources for a gender equal world. 

Catalyzing Change 2024

Our inaugural Catalyzing Change report affirmed our theory of change and deepened our understanding of how WMM strengthens members’ personal growth, leadership, advocacy, and grantmaking.

Catalyzing Change 2025

Building on our inaugural report, the second Catalyzing Change report offered a deeper examination of WMM members’ philanthropic giving, leadership, and collaborative efforts to drive gender equality, focusing especially on the ripple effects of member philanthropy in the gender equality landscape.

Meeting the Moment 2025

This midyear survey focused on members' response to rising global instability and how they were responding to meet the challenges of the moment, revealing an increasingly collaborative approach with members working together to meet immediate needs and long-term movement sustainability.

Catalyzing Change 2026

Our third Catalyzing Change report examines how WMM members have responded to a period of instability with increased giving, deeper collaboration, and more trust-based philanthropy, highlighting the critical role community plays in strengthening members’ leadership and ability to move resources boldly in support of gender equality.
